Nils Petter Molvaer has written the score to a brand new TV series (three episodes) on NRK about the dramatic year of 1905 when Norway decided to break out of the union with Sweden and asked the Danish prince Carl to become the king of Norway. The series is called “Harry & Charles” and can be viewed on NRK Nett-TV (http://www1.nrk.no/nett-tv/ ) now.

NPM’s score has been arranged for orchestra by Brede Rørstad and is performed by The Norwegian Radio Orchestra (http://www.nrk.no/informasjon/organisasjonen/kringkastingsorkestret/3430654.html ).
NPM is also credited as playing “various instruments”.

This week David Sylvian’s SamadhiSound just sent these news:

 “Jan Bang releases his debut album with us in 2010. '...and Poppies from Kandahar' is marked by Jan's amazingly acute ear for sound design and his ability to create and sustain delicate, but powerfully evocative, moods of sonic and textural complexity. Some of you might be familiar with Jan's remix work for David Sylvian in collaboration with his Punkt partner, Erik Honoré. This team was also responsible for co- writing / producing Arve Henriksen's 'Cartography' (ecm). '... and poppies from Kandahar' could be seen as something of a companion piece to the latter featuring, as it does, contributions from Henriksen, Jon Hassell, Sidsel Endresen, Eivind Aarset and many more.” (mg)

26. May 2009 > Eivind Aarset & the Sonic Codex Orchestra will appear @ Moers Festival, may 30, 2009:
Eivind Aarset is one of the busiest musicians in Norway. He has appeared in Moers with Nils Petter Molvaer (1998 and 2006) and last year with the “punkt guerilla Team”. He is a “musician’s musician” in the best sense: his name appears on the covers of over 100 of his colleagues’ albums. He appears in Moers this year with his dream constellation, an exclusive extension of his breathtakingly groovy Sonic Codex Orchestra. lineup: Eivind Aarset - g, electr, Gunnar Halle - tr, Audun Erlien - b, g,
Björn Charles Dreyer - b, g, Wetle Holte - dr, Erland Dahlen - dr

  >   MIC (music information centre norway) published a NPM feature online:
http://ballade.no Some "highlights" from the interview above (kindly translated by jont)::
- NPM wanted the new album to be more open, more played and less programmed.
- He recorded all the concerts he played last autumn. He also did some field recordings from different places, and recorded some music at his parents' loft during christmas. NPM, Eivind Aarset, Jan Bang and Johnny Skalleberg did a 3 day trip to a cottage where they recorded sketches and ideas. The result is what NPM describes as a "sound pool" that he could build upon. There are still several terabytes of material from this process that he hasn't used.
- The album is mixed in Tromsø, Norway by NPM and Jon Marius Aareskjold. Aareskjold is part of the production team Espionage, which have worked a lot with pop and r&b artists like Rihanna. Also ex Tungtvann (Norwegian hip hop band) DJ and producer Lars "Poppa" Audun Sandness has been assistant on the mixing.
- When asked about his own musical development, he says that he tries to be as emotionally precise as possible without being pretentious. "I don't want to play a lot of stuff that doesn't lead anywhere, but have a clear direction in what I play. But other than that, it's quite difficult for me to say something about the development from album to album, because I don't listen very much to my earlier albums."
- NPM is going to create music for a mini series for Norwegian television. The series is called "Harry & Charles" and is supposed to be aired around christmas of 2009. For this music he is going to use a symphonic orchestra, which he thinks will be quite a challenge. The series takes place in the year of 1905, so the music will have to sound like it could have been written at that time. He wants to find a mix between more modern stuff and the symphonic orchestra (jtu)

> Nils Petter Molvær is actually mastering his new album HAMADA :-)
read his blog entry @ myspace:
"... the name could probably mean many things.I know there is a Japanese Sumo-wrestler called Hamada,and also a butterfly they found in India. It also means a landscape...A barren ,rocky highland in a desert.It is the theme of many of the songs..or at least the titles of the songs.F.x SABKAH. Meaning  "A region of formerly flooded coastal desert in which stranded seawater has left a salt crust over a mire of mud that is rich in organic material." (pps)
